Official abstract text for this publication.
A compact collapsible stroller in accordance with the present disclosure includes a mobile cart and a seat coupled to the mobile cart. The mobile cart includes a rolling base and a foldable frame that fold inwardly and outwardly from the rolling base.

The invention claimed is: 1. A mobile cart adapted for use in a stroller, the mobile cart comprising a rolling base including a left wheeled leg and a right wheeled leg, a foldable frame including a base stabilizer coupled to the rolling base to pivot about a frame axis and a base pusher coupled to the rolling base to pivot about a pusher axis, and a frame-motion controller adapted to provide fold means for releasing the foldable frame to move from a folded-out position in which the base stabilizer and the base pusher extend away from the rolling base to support a child sitting on a seat mounted to the mobile cart when the mobile cart is in use to a folded-in position in which the base stabilizer and the base pusher extend along the rolling base reducing the footprint of the mobile cart to allow storage of the mobile cart in response to a user lifting upwardly with one hand on a fold handle included in the frame-motion controller and for coordinating movement of the base stabilizer included in the foldable frame and the base pusher included in the foldable frame as they move from the folded-out position to the folded-in position in response to continued upward lifting of the fold handle with one hand by a user that causes a gravitational force to pull the base stabilizer and the base pusher of the foldable frame toward the folded-in position so that a user can move the foldable frame from the folded-out position to the folded-in position for storage using only a first hand freeing a second hand to carry a child, wherein the frame-motion controller includes a left pivot lock coupled to the left wheeled leg along a left side of the rolling base, a right pivot lock coupled to the right wheeled leg along a right side of the rolling base, and the fold handle that interconnects the left pivot lock and the right pivot lock, wherein each of the left pivot lock and the right pivot lock includes a motion blocker coupled to the rolling base to slide relative to the rolling base from a locked position arranged to block the base stabilizer included in the foldable frame and the base pusher included in the foldable frame from rotation relative to the rolling base when the foldable frame is in the folded-out position to an unlocked position arranged to allow the base stabilizer included in the foldable frame and the base pusher included in the foldable frame to rotate relative to the rolling base when the foldable frame is in the folded-out position, and wherein the base stabilizer includes a stabilizer frame member, a left pivot hub coupled to the stabilizer frame member, and a right pivot hub coupled to the stabilizer frame member, each of the left and the right pivot hubs is formed to include a stabilizer frame receiver that receives a portion of the stabilizer frame member to couple the left and the right pivot hubs to the stabilizer frame member and a finger that extends away from the stabilizer frame member, and the fingers of the left and the right pivot hubs included in the base stabilizer are engaged by the motion blockers of the corresponding left and right pivot locks to block rotation of the base stabilizer relative to the rolling base when the foldable frame is in the folded-out position and the motion blockers of the left and the right pivot locks are in the locked position. 2. The mobile cart of claim 1 , wherein each of the left and the right pivot locks includes a biasing member arranged to bias the corresponding motion blocker toward the locked position, each of the fingers of the left and the right pivot hubs included in the base stabilizer is formed to include an engagement surface and a cam surface, the engagement surface of each of the fingers of the left and the right pivot hubs included in the base stabilizer is arranged to extend at a right angle from the stabilizer frame member and to be engaged by the motion blockers of the corresponding left and right pivot locks to block rotation of the base stabilizer relative to the rolling base when the foldable frame is in the folded-out position and the motion blockers of the left and the right pivot locks are in the locked position, and the cam surface of each of the fingers of the left and the right pivot hubs included in the base stabilizer is arranged to extend at a cam angle from the stabilizer frame member and to push the motion blockers of the corresponding left and right pivot locks from the locked position to the unlocked position during movement of the foldable frame from the folded-in position to the folded-out position. 3. The mobile cart of claim 1 , wherein the base pusher includes a pusher frame member, a left pivot hub coupled to the pusher frame member, and a right pivot hub coupled to the pusher frame member, each of the left and the right pivot hubs is formed to include a pusher frame receiver that receives a portion of the pusher frame member to couple the left and the right pivot hubs to the pusher frame member and a finger that extends away from the pusher frame member, and the fingers of the left and the right pivot hubs included in the base pusher are engaged by the motion blockers of the corresponding left and right pivot locks to block rotation of the base pusher relative to the rolling base when the foldable frame is in the folded-out position and the motion blockers of the left and the right pivot locks are in the locked position. 4. The mobile cart of claim 3 , wherein each of the fingers of the left and the right pivot hubs included in the base pusher is formed to include an engagement surface and a cam surface, the engagement surface of each of the fingers of the left and the right pivot hubs included in the base pusher is arranged to extend at a right angle from the pusher frame member and to be engaged by the motion blockers of the corresponding left and right pivot locks to block rotation of the base pusher relative to the rolling base when the foldable frame is in the folded-out position and the motion blockers of the left and the right pivot locks are in the locked position, and the cam surface of each of the fingers of the left and the right pivot hubs included in the base pusher are arranged to extend at a cam angle from the pusher frame member and to push the motion blockers of the corresponding left and right pivot locks from the locked position to the unlocked position during movement of the foldable frame from the folded-in position to the folded-out position. 5. The mobile cart of claim 3 , wherein each of the left and the right pivot locks includes a housing coupled to the rolling base and at least a portion of the motion blocker, the fingers of the left and the right pivot hubs included in the rolling base stabilizer, and the fingers of the left and the right pivot hubs included in the base pusher are arranged inside the housings of the left and the right pivot locks. 6. The mobile cart of claim 1 , wherein the frame-motion controller includes a left link and a right link adapted to coordinate movement of the base stabilizer and the base pusher during motion of the foldable frame between the folded-out position and the folded-in position, the left link is coupled to the base stabilizer to pivot relative to the base stabilizer and coupled to the base pusher to pivot relative to the base pusher, and the right link is coupled to the base stabilizer to pivot relative to the base stabilizer and coupled to the base pusher to pivot relative to the base pusher. 7.
